use serde::{Deserialize, Serialize};
use serde_json::Map;
#[derive(Debug, Clone, Serialize, Deserialize, Default)]
#[serde(rename_all = "camelCase")]
pub struct ListSchemasParams {
pub location_id: String,
#[serde(skip_serializing_if = "Option::is_none")]
pub limit: Option<u32>,
#[serde(skip_serializing_if = "Option::is_none")]
pub offset: Option<u32>,
}
#[derive(Debug, Clone, Serialize, Deserialize)]
#[serde(rename_all = "camelCase")]
pub struct ObjectSchema {
pub id: String,
pub key: String,
pub name: String,
pub location_id: String,
#[serde(skip_serializing_if = "Option::is_none")]
pub description: Option<String>,
#[serde(default)]
pub fields: Vec<SchemaField>,
#[serde(skip_serializing_if = "Option::is_none")]
pub date_added: Option<String>,
#[serde(skip_serializing_if = "Option::is_none")]
pub date_updated: Option<String>,
}
#[derive(Debug, Clone, Serialize, Deserialize)]
#[serde(rename_all = "camelCase")]
pub struct SchemaField {
pub key: String,
pub name: String,
pub field_type: String,
#[serde(skip_serializing_if = "Option::is_none")]
pub is_required: Option<bool>,
#[serde(skip_serializing_if = "Option::is_none")]
pub is_unique: Option<bool>,
}
#[derive(Debug, Clone, Serialize, Deserialize)]
pub struct ListSchemasResponse {
pub objects: Vec<ObjectSchema>,
#[serde(skip_serializing_if = "Option::is_none")]
pub count: Option<u64>,
#[serde(skip_serializing_if = "Option::is_none")]
pub total: Option<u64>,
}
#[derive(Debug, Clone, Serialize, Deserialize)]
pub struct GetSchemaResponse {
pub object: ObjectSchema,
}
#[derive(Debug, Clone, Serialize, Deserialize, Default)]
#[serde(rename_all = "camelCase")]
pub struct CreateSchemaParams {
pub name: String,
#[serde(skip_serializing_if = "Option::is_none")]
pub description: Option<String>,
pub fields: Vec<CreateSchemaField>,
}
#[derive(Debug, Clone, Serialize, Deserialize)]
#[serde(rename_all = "camelCase")]
pub struct CreateSchemaField {
pub key: String,
pub name: String,
pub field_type: String,
#[serde(skip_serializing_if = "Option::is_none")]
pub is_required: Option<bool>,
#[serde(skip_serializing_if = "Option::is_none")]
pub is_unique: Option<bool>,
}
#[derive(Debug, Clone, Serialize, Deserialize, Default)]
#[serde(rename_all = "camelCase")]
pub struct UpdateSchemaParams {
#[serde(skip_serializing_if = "Option::is_none")]
pub name: Option<String>,
#[serde(skip_serializing_if = "Option::is_none")]
pub description: Option<String>,
#[serde(skip_serializing_if = "Option::is_none")]
pub fields: Option<Vec<CreateSchemaField>>,
}
#[derive(Debug, Clone, Serialize, Deserialize, Default)]
#[serde(rename_all = "camelCase")]
pub struct CreateRecordParams {
pub location_id: String,
pub properties: Map<String, serde_json::Value>,
}
#[derive(Debug, Clone, Serialize, Deserialize, Default)]
#[serde(rename_all = "camelCase")]
pub struct UpdateRecordParams {
pub properties: Map<String, serde_json::Value>,
}
#[derive(Debug, Clone, Serialize, Deserialize)]
#[serde(rename_all = "camelCase")]
pub struct ObjectRecord {
pub id: String,
pub location_id: String,
pub schema_key: String,
pub properties: Map<String, serde_json::Value>,
#[serde(skip_serializing_if = "Option::is_none")]
pub date_added: Option<String>,
#[serde(skip_serializing_if = "Option::is_none")]
pub date_updated: Option<String>,
}
#[derive(Debug, Clone, Serialize, Deserialize)]
pub struct GetRecordResponse {
pub record: ObjectRecord,
}
#[derive(Debug, Clone, Serialize, Deserialize)]
pub struct CreateRecordResponse {
pub record: ObjectRecord,
}
#[derive(Debug, Clone, Serialize, Deserialize)]
pub struct DeleteRecordResponse {
pub succeeded: bool,
}
#[derive(Debug, Clone, Serialize, Deserialize)]
#[serde(rename_all = "camelCase")]
pub struct SearchRecordsParams {
pub location_id: String,
#[serde(skip_serializing_if = "Option::is_none")]
pub limit: Option<u32>,
#[serde(skip_serializing_if = "Option::is_none")]
pub offset: Option<u32>,
#[serde(skip_serializing_if = "Option::is_none")]
pub filters: Option<Vec<SearchFilter>>,
}
#[derive(Debug, Clone, Serialize, Deserialize)]
#[serde(rename_all = "camelCase")]
pub struct SearchFilter {
pub field: String,
pub operator: FilterOperator,
pub value: serde_json::Value,
}
#[derive(Debug, Clone, Serialize, Deserialize)]
#[serde(rename_all = "snake_case")]
pub enum FilterOperator {
Equals,
NotEquals,
Contains,
NotContains,
GreaterThan,
LessThan,
GreaterThanOrEquals,
LessThanOrEquals,
Exists,
NotExists,
In,
NotIn,
Between,
}
#[derive(Debug, Clone, Serialize, Deserialize)]
#[serde(rename_all = "camelCase")]
pub struct SearchRecordsResponse {
pub records: Vec<ObjectRecord>,
#[serde(skip_serializing_if = "Option::is_none")]
pub total: Option<u64>,
#[serde(skip_serializing_if = "Option::is_none")]
pub count: Option<u64>,
}
